KestrelServerOptionsHttpsExtensions.UseHttps Метод

Определение

Перегрузки

UseHttps(KestrelServerOptions, HttpsConnectionFilterOptions)

Настройте Kestrel для использования протокола HTTPS.

UseHttps(KestrelServerOptions, X509Certificate2)

Настройте Kestrel для использования протокола HTTPS.

UseHttps(KestrelServerOptions, String)

Настройте Kestrel для использования протокола HTTPS.

UseHttps(KestrelServerOptions, String, String)

Настройте Kestrel для использования протокола HTTPS.

UseHttps(KestrelServerOptions, HttpsConnectionFilterOptions)

Настройте Kestrel для использования протокола HTTPS.

public:
[System::Runtime::CompilerServices::Extension]
 static Microsoft::AspNetCore::Server::Kestrel::KestrelServerOptions ^ UseHttps(Microsoft::AspNetCore::Server::Kestrel::KestrelServerOptions ^ options, Microsoft::AspNetCore::Server::Kestrel::Https::HttpsConnectionFilterOptions ^ httpsOptions);
public static Microsoft.AspNetCore.Server.Kestrel.KestrelServerOptions UseHttps (this Microsoft.AspNetCore.Server.Kestrel.KestrelServerOptions options, Microsoft.AspNetCore.Server.Kestrel.Https.HttpsConnectionFilterOptions httpsOptions);
static member UseHttps : Microsoft.AspNetCore.Server.Kestrel.KestrelServerOptions * Microsoft.AspNetCore.Server.Kestrel.Https.HttpsConnectionFilterOptions -> Microsoft.AspNetCore.Server.Kestrel.KestrelServerOptions
<Extension()>
Public Function UseHttps (options As KestrelServerOptions, httpsOptions As HttpsConnectionFilterOptions) As KestrelServerOptions

Параметры

options
KestrelServerOptions

Microsoft.AspNetCore.Server.KestrelServerOptions для настройки.

httpsOptions
HttpsConnectionFilterOptions

Параметры для настройки HTTPS.

Возвращаемое значение

The Microsoft.AspNetCore.Server.KestrelServerOptions.

Применяется к

UseHttps(KestrelServerOptions, X509Certificate2)

Настройте Kestrel для использования протокола HTTPS.

public:
[System::Runtime::CompilerServices::Extension]
 static Microsoft::AspNetCore::Server::Kestrel::KestrelServerOptions ^ UseHttps(Microsoft::AspNetCore::Server::Kestrel::KestrelServerOptions ^ options, System::Security::Cryptography::X509Certificates::X509Certificate2 ^ serverCertificate);
public static Microsoft.AspNetCore.Server.Kestrel.KestrelServerOptions UseHttps (this Microsoft.AspNetCore.Server.Kestrel.KestrelServerOptions options, System.Security.Cryptography.X509Certificates.X509Certificate2 serverCertificate);
static member UseHttps : Microsoft.AspNetCore.Server.Kestrel.KestrelServerOptions * System.Security.Cryptography.X509Certificates.X509Certificate2 -> Microsoft.AspNetCore.Server.Kestrel.KestrelServerOptions
<Extension()>
Public Function UseHttps (options As KestrelServerOptions, serverCertificate As X509Certificate2) As KestrelServerOptions

Параметры

options
KestrelServerOptions

Microsoft.AspNetCore.Server.KestrelServerOptions для настройки.

serverCertificate
X509Certificate2

Сертификат X.509.

Возвращаемое значение

The Microsoft.AspNetCore.Server.KestrelServerOptions.

Применяется к

UseHttps(KestrelServerOptions, String)

Настройте Kestrel для использования протокола HTTPS.

public:
[System::Runtime::CompilerServices::Extension]
 static Microsoft::AspNetCore::Server::Kestrel::KestrelServerOptions ^ UseHttps(Microsoft::AspNetCore::Server::Kestrel::KestrelServerOptions ^ options, System::String ^ fileName);
public static Microsoft.AspNetCore.Server.Kestrel.KestrelServerOptions UseHttps (this Microsoft.AspNetCore.Server.Kestrel.KestrelServerOptions options, string fileName);
static member UseHttps : Microsoft.AspNetCore.Server.Kestrel.KestrelServerOptions * string -> Microsoft.AspNetCore.Server.Kestrel.KestrelServerOptions
<Extension()>
Public Function UseHttps (options As KestrelServerOptions, fileName As String) As KestrelServerOptions

Параметры

options
KestrelServerOptions

Microsoft.AspNetCore.Server.KestrelServerOptions для настройки.

fileName
String

Имя файла сертификата относительно каталога, содержащего файлы содержимого приложения.

Возвращаемое значение

The Microsoft.AspNetCore.Server.KestrelServerOptions.

Применяется к

UseHttps(KestrelServerOptions, String, String)

Настройте Kestrel для использования протокола HTTPS.

public:
[System::Runtime::CompilerServices::Extension]
 static Microsoft::AspNetCore::Server::Kestrel::KestrelServerOptions ^ UseHttps(Microsoft::AspNetCore::Server::Kestrel::KestrelServerOptions ^ options, System::String ^ fileName, System::String ^ password);
public static Microsoft.AspNetCore.Server.Kestrel.KestrelServerOptions UseHttps (this Microsoft.AspNetCore.Server.Kestrel.KestrelServerOptions options, string fileName, string password);
static member UseHttps : Microsoft.AspNetCore.Server.Kestrel.KestrelServerOptions * string * string -> Microsoft.AspNetCore.Server.Kestrel.KestrelServerOptions
<Extension()>
Public Function UseHttps (options As KestrelServerOptions, fileName As String, password As String) As KestrelServerOptions

Параметры

options
KestrelServerOptions

Microsoft.AspNetCore.Server.KestrelServerOptions для настройки.

fileName
String

Имя файла сертификата относительно каталога, содержащего файлы содержимого приложения.

password
String

Пароль для доступа к данным сертификата X.509.

Возвращаемое значение

The Microsoft.AspNetCore.Server.KestrelServerOptions.

Применяется к